Samples in liquid variety are injected into the HPLC just after a suitable clean up-up to get rid of any particulate elements, or right after a suitable extraction to get rid of matrix interferents. In figuring out polyaromatic hydrocarbons (PAH) in wastewater, one example is, an extraction with CH2Cl2 serves the twin objective of concentrating the analytes and isolating them from matrix interferents. Reliable samples are initially dissolved in an acceptable solvent, or even the analytes of desire introduced into Option by extraction. One example is, an HPLC analysis for your Energetic elements and degradation products and solutions inside a pharmaceutical pill usually commences by extracting the powdered pill having a percentage of cellular period.

One limitation to the packed capillary column could be the back again stress that develops when wanting to move the cell section through the little interstitial Areas between the particulate micron-sized packing substance (Determine 12.forty). website Because the tubing and fittings that carry the cellular period have force limits, a higher again force requires a reduced circulation level and a longer analysis time. Monolithic columns, through which the strong assist is only one, porous rod, offer column efficiencies such as a packed capillary column whilst enabling for quicker circulation premiums.

In case the stationary section is a lot more polar as opposed to cell phase, the separation is deemed standard period. If the stationary phase is considerably less polar than the cellular section, the separation is reverse section. In reverse section HPLC the retention time of the compound increases with decreasing polarity of The actual species. The main element to a powerful and economical separation is to find out the suitable ratio involving polar and non-polar components from the cellular stage.
